TIME IN TRANSPORT: A PERVERTED PROBLEM? ARGUMENTS FOR A FRESH LOOK AT TIME UTILITY RESEARCH AND APPLICATION. TOI REPORT SUMMARY
Time in transport is a wide-ranging subject and one in which great interest has been shown, as indicated by the extensive literature. However, this interest has been completely dominated by one aspect, i.e. the conversion of time to money and different ideas of how time saved may be expressed in monetary terms. This is important enough, but only a limited part of the whole subject. But the literature, which includes consultants' reports and traffic investment plans for specific cases, has ignored the basic problems which must be solved first in order for an economic evaluation to be meaningful.
